- Description
- Portobello Road's asparagus vodka represents an unconventional London distillery project, pairing fresh English asparagus with potato vodka base. The nose and palate deliver distinct herbaceous and grassy character with subtle nuttiness, moving well beyond typical vodka expectations. This works best in savory applications—as the foundation for a Bloody Mary or in a clean, botanical Martini variation. It appeals to those seeking vegetable-forward spirits and adventurous cocktail experimentation.
